JANE  CULPEPPER  LINDSAY


            ABBEVILLE. . .Jane Culpepper Lindsay, a resident of Abbeville, died Sunday afternoon, January 15, 2017, at her home. She was 85.


            Funeral services will be held at 11:00 A.M. Tuesday, January 17, 2017, in the Calvary Baptist Church with Reverend Teddy Ward, Pastor Alan Capps and Reverend Henry Fullington officiating. Burial will follow in the Abbeville Memorial Cemetery. Holman-Abbeville Mortuary & Cremations is in charge of arrangements. The family will receive friends from 10:00 until 11:00 A.M. Tuesday in the church sanctuary.


            In lieu of flowers, memorial contributions may be made to the Calvary Baptist Church Playground Fund, 310 Dothan Road, Abbeville, AL 36310 or the Abbeville Christian Academy Capital Campaign, P.O. Box 9, Abbeville, AL 36310.


            Mrs. Lindsay was a lifelong resident of Abbeville, daughter of the late Joseph Bertram Culpepper and Mary Nancy Money Culpepper. She was a 1949 graduate of Abbeville High School. Mrs. Lindsay was an active member of the Calvary Baptist Church where she served as the church clerk for many years. She was a member of the Elaine Brown Sunday School Class, the W.M.U., served as Secretary/Treasurer of the Jewel Club and was a member of the Joy Club. Mrs. Lindsay and her late husband served in the Primary Department of the Calvary Baptist Church for many years. She retired from the Agricultural Stabilization Conservation Service after twenty-eight years employment. Mrs. Lindsay was an avid bridge player a former member of the Porch House Bridge Club and several bridge clubs in Abbeville and Dothan. In earlier years, she was a member of the 70’s Southland Bank Travel Club. Mrs. Lindsay and her late husband were avid Auburn fans. She was preceded in death by her husband, William Scott Lindsay and a brother, Joseph Bertram Culpepper, Jr.


            Surviving relatives include a daughter, Nan Armstrong (Lawton Ed), Abbeville; two sons, William Scott Lindsay, Jr.; and Herbert Warren Lindsay, Moody, AL; five grandchildren, Jason Selva (Dawn), Lindsay McDaniel, Ashleigh Lindsay Weems (Jason), Joseph Armstrong and Allison Lindsay; eight great-grandchildren, William Wise, Andrew Norton, Murphy Selva, Ellie Jae Weems, Jase Selva, Madilyn McDaniel, Makenzi McDaniel and Logan Blalock; a special cousin, Annie Ruth Hubbard Archibald; two nieces, Cathy McNeal (Mike) and Cindy Volf (Gene), a nephew, Bert Culpepper; several great-nieces and great-nephews.


            Serving as active pallbearers will be Jason Selva, Joseph Armstrong, Jason Weems, Bert Culpepper, Wayne Scott, Lawton Ed Armstrong and Bill Roberts.


            The family would like to express their appreciation to Home Instead and Gentiva Hospice for the loving care and kindness shown to Mrs. Lindsay during her illness.
